Description
Pinn Cottage, originally Pinn Farmhouse, dates to 1633, although deeds from 1619 refer to the property. This is an appealing, low two-story cottage constructed of cob, with a thatched roof and end half-dormers. It has a four-window front featuring 19th-century three-light casement windows. A thatched porch is present, and original beams remain visible in several of the rooms. The cottage is situated on a lane to the west of the Bowd Inn, within a hamlet on the north-western boundary of the urban district.
